Transaction 57697141d2054459ad815ba1197b491362ba591b447ed14056a59a19a44b29f6

1 Input
2 Outputs
  • 57697141d2054459ad815ba1197b491362ba591b447ed14056a59a19a44b29f6:0
  • value  31354246184
    address  13y5hABuhSLS9RrTa88mXYeoc73UMBGD3N
  • 57697141d2054459ad815ba1197b491362ba591b447ed14056a59a19a44b29f6:1
  • value  118702816
    address  121NTjewd54NkwHrsofKjBGGa6ztNToV2m